"Triumph of Mordecai" is a pen and ink drawing by the Italian artist Giuseppe Piattoli (1785-1807) held in the collection of The Art Institute of Chicago. The drawing depicts a scene from the biblical story of Esther, where Mordecai, the Jewish hero, rides through the streets of Shushan on a horse while the people cheer him on. This drawing, like many of Piattoli's works, was created as a study for a larger painting, showcasing the artist's technical skills and attention to detail. The use of pen and ink allows for a sense of movement and fluidity, capturing the energy of the scene.
